With the increase in our standard of living, technology, and innovation, we’re dealing with the problem of abundance.

We have to deal with shiny object syndrome because of the abundance of choices.

The “Could Be” doesn’t let us be what we are. And we keep ruminating about the 14 million 605 possibilities.

The “Could Be” doesn’t let us be what we are.

Even as creators, we get confused between too many platforms, strategies, and multiple side hustles.

This problem has made all of us overthinkers, and ADHD rates are higher than ever.

Is there something we can do about it? Let’s figure it out.

The Problem of “Too Much”

The biggest problem with creators is we have too many options. Every day billions are being spent on the creator economy. New platforms are emerging, and new tropical trends are becoming viral.
